WebApr 6, 2024 · Modern periodic law states that physical and chemical properties of the elements are periodic function of the atomic numbers i.e. if the elements are arranged in order of their increasing atomic numbers, the elements with similar properties are repeated after certain regular intervals. Web2. Newlands Law of Octaves 3. Mendeleev s Periodic Law & Periodic Tables 4. Modern Periodic Table 6.1.3 Dobereiner s Triads In 1829, J.W. Dobereiner, a German chemist made groups of three elements each and called them triads (Table 6.1). All three elements of a triad were similar in their physical and chemical properties. Modern periodic table (Figure 1) is based on the modern periodic law. Figure 1. Main features: Groups - There are 18 vertical columns in the periodic table. Each column is called a group.
